Substitutive structure of a lysergamide.

Amides of lysergic acid are collectively known as Lysergamides.

Ergoline refers to a class of compounds derived from alkaloids of a group of fungi known as Ergot, in the Claviceps genus. These compounds typically have have strong psychedelic effects.

Chemistry

Lysergamides, tabulated by structure (Wikipedia)

Name R1 R6 R2 R3
LSA / LAA H CH3 H H
DAM-57 H CH3 CH3 CH3
Ergometrine (Ergonovine) H CH3 CH(CH3)CH2OH H
Ergotamine H CH3 -- C17H18N2O4
Methergine H CH3 CH(CH2CH3)CH2OH H
Methysergide CH3 CH3 CH(CH2CH3)CH2OH H
LAE-32 H CH3 CH2CH3 H
LSB H CH3 CH(CH3)CH2CH3 H
LSP H CH3 CH(CH2CH3)CH2CH3 H
DAL H CH3 H2C=CH-CH2 H2C=CH-CH2
MIPLA H CH3 CH(CH3)2 CH3
EIPLA H CH3 CH(CH3)2 CH2CH3
LAMP H CH3 CH2CH2CH3 CH3
LSD / LAD H CH3 CH2CH3 CH2CH3
ETH-LAD H CH2CH3 CH2CH3 CH2CH3
PARGY-LAD H HC≡C−CH2 CH2CH3 CH2CH3
AL-LAD H H2C=CH-CH2 CH2CH3 CH2CH3
PRO-LAD H CH2CH2CH3 CH2CH3 CH2CH3
CYP-LAD H C3H5 CH2CH3 CH2CH3
BU-LAD H CH2CH2CH2CH3 CH2CH3 CH2CH3
ALD-52 COCH3 CH3 CH2CH3 CH2CH3
MLD-41 CH3 CH3 CH2CH3 CH2CH3
LSM-775 H CH3 CH2CH2-O-CH2CH2
LPD-824 H CH3 CH2CH2 CH2CH2
LSD-Pip H CH3 CH2CH2 CH2CH2CH2
LA-SS-Az H CH3 CH2(CHCH3)2CH2

Pharmacology

Lysergamides are believed to produce their psychedelic effect primarily by partial agonism of 5-HT2A receptors.
